Today “Made in China” is no longer synonymous with poor quality, and consumers are promoting a Chinese nationalism that is influencing consumer habits across the country. Guochao means “national wave” or “national trend” and refers to the new consumer habits that are emerging in China. Indeed, consumers, especially young people, want to see their culture […]

Review sections are now ubiquitous across e-commerce platforms and today, nine out of ten consumers in China look to customer reviews before buying a product. Reviews from average customers now hold more weight than ever before.
